Excerpt from Four Years at Yale I am aware that the arrangement of this book 15 to some extent arbitrary. I accepted it only as a choice of evils. But I hope that the head-lines placed before each Chapter, and the Index at the end, may in great part compensate for this defect. I know, too, that there are in it many repetitions and some seeming contradic tions and inconsistencies. I perceive how easy it will be to mis quote my work, and to use isolated and disconnected portions of it to the detriment of particular interests of the college, or even of the institution itself. I regret the fact most keenly; yet, after all, such snap-judgments are of less account than deliberate opinions drawn froma full consideration of all the facts, and I firmly believe that anyone who reads this book to the end will have no worse opinion of Yale life from knowing what it really is. If the event proves otherwise, so much the worse for the facts but these ought none the less to be made known. What I ask is, that they should all be taken into account; and that hasty conclusions should not be jumped at, from a partial or one-sided glance at the evidence. Excerpt from Yale Yesterdays Clarence Deming was known to many but under stood by few. This was not due to any reserve, either of manner or of expression, on his part. As a jour malist he was obliged constantly to come into contact with all sorts and conditions of men. Through his writings he was known to many who had never seen him. If, nevertheless, comparatively few really under stood the nature and character of the man, the cause lay, not in any concealment on his part, but rather in an altogether exceptional frankness and honesty. His scorn of appearances and of conventions was so great that appearances Often did him injustice. In an age which attaches such value to the label as to throw about it the protection Of the law, he was willing to go without any label, rather than wear one that he might not merit. Few knew that words which sounded blunt voiced a disposition kindly and gentle, as well as an honesty Of purpose so courageous, that it was indifferent to the impression produced on others. His courage was especially conspicuous when, as Often happened, he was engaged in fighting some political or moral wrong. Then the recording journalist was con verted into the reforming citizen, and he would keep up the fight regardless of the prejudice or indifference Of those who should have helped him.
